Figure 7
ONO- and dDAVP-induced cAMP production in mouse IMCD tubule suspensions.

(A and B) Drug-induced increases in cAMP levels in mouse IMCD tubule suspensions. Freshly isolated IMCD tubule suspensions from C57BL/6 WT mice (10-week-old males; n = 7 per individual experiment) were pooled and equally distributed into 24-well plates. Samples were treated with the indicated concentrations of ONO (A) or dDAVP (B) for 30 minutes at 37°C. Total cAMP generated in each well was normalized to the amount of protein present in each well. Four independent experiments were carried out. Data are provided as mean ± SEM.
